Features
Rothco’s 4 Color OCP Face Paint Compact features four colors that are perfect for military use, tactical professionals, hunters, and more. This camo face paint compact is designed to match the military’s Occupational Camouflage Pattern (OCP). The pocket-sizes plastic case measures 3 inches x 2 ¼ inches x ¾ inches. The face paint contains lanolin oil and mineral oil, no nut oils are used.
